Output 82e262248b71a8ab74d9afd2923b75c0d2c9a2eaef8df82b90ff185b43935513:0

value
27425000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eac91cf2a475eaca8fb216fdf59e4a6e1357a810 OP_EQUAL
address
MVJbGuABqr6wFMZq5heDb4CJr94vpxhxfg
transaction
82e262248b71a8ab74d9afd2923b75c0d2c9a2eaef8df82b90ff185b43935513
spent
true